EnglishMain Dictionary
approval
Universal Words
noun
1 [U] the feeling that sb/sth is good or acceptable; a positive opinion of sb/sth:
She desperately wanted to win her father's approval. * Do the plans meet with your approval? * Several people nodded in approval.
2 [U,C] ~ (for sth) (from sb) agreement to, or permission for sth, especially a plan or request:
The plan will be submitted to the committee for official approval. * parliamentary / congressional / government approval * Senior management have given their seal of approval (= formal approval) to the plans. * I can't agree to anything without my partner's approval. * planning approvals * They required / received approval for the proposal from the shareholders.
3 [U] if you buy goods, or if goods are sold on approval, you can use them for a time without paying, until you decide if you want to buy them or not